<br />ENGINEER KEN DAMEROW POINTED OUT THE BOUNDARIES OF THIS AREA
<br />LOCATED SOUTH OF THE CITY LIMITS, NOTING THAT IT INCLUDES VISTA ROYALE AND
<br />MANY SMALL FRANCHISE AREAS.
<br />COMMISSIONER SIEBERT STATED THAT THE REASON FOR CREATING A
<br />DISTRICT IN THIS AREA IS THE PROLIFERATION OF SMALL FRANCHISE HOLDERS THAT -
<br />ARE HAVING DIFFICULTY MEETING STATE STANDARDS,
<br />IN DISCUSSION IT WAS AGREED THAT THIS IS PROBABLY THE SECOND
<br />GREATEST PROBLEM AREA,
